Financing Cost
The total expense a company bears to finance its operations, including interest, dividends, and other costs related to obtaining capital.
Bond Rating
An assessment or grade given to bonds that indicates their credit quality and the likelihood of the issuer defaulting.
Investment Grade
A rating that indicates a municipal or corporate bond has a relatively low risk of default, making it an attractive investment option for risk-averse investors.
Yield to Call
The yield of a bond or note if you were to buy and hold the security until the call date.
